The RPM collection presents a range of subject matter, some of their time such as 'Hiroshima' and 'Harlem Lady', others love songs that transcend time. The English had Donovan, the Americans had Dylan, the Irish had McWilliams...
The combination of McWilliams heartfelt lyrics and songstyle with Leanders evocative arrangements of the simple melodies still sound bewitching today. 'The Days Of Pearly Spencer' was covered by Marc Almond in the early 90's and 'Three O'Clock Flamingo Street' is another radio favourite.
